Nestled in the heart of Hyderabad, the Paigah Tombs stand as a testament to the rich history and architectural brilliance of the region. These intricately designed tombs, built in the 19th century, showcase a unique blend of Indo-Saracenic architecture, adorned with exquisite carvings and detailed motifs. A visit to the Paigah Tombs offers tourists a serene escape into the past, highlighting the legacy of the Paigah nobility who played a significant role in Hyderabad's history. The lush gardens surrounding the tombs provide a tranquil setting for leisurely exploration and reflection.

Car
If you are driving from the center of Hyderabad, start on Nehru Outer Ring Road and take the exit toward Sagar Ring Road. Continue on Sagar Ring Road for about 8 km, then take the exit toward Santosh Nagar. Follow the signs for Santosh Nagar and continue straight until you reach Qalender Nagar Rd. The Paigah Tombs will be on your right-hand side. There is parking available near the entrance.
Public Transport (Bus)
From Hyderabad, you can take a TSRTC bus heading towards Santosh Nagar. Buses frequently depart from major bus stations like Mahatma Gandhi Bus Station (MGBS) or JBS. The fare is usually around ₹20-₹30. Get off at the Santosh Nagar bus stop, and from there, it's a short 10-minute walk to Qalender Nagar Rd where the Paigah Tombs are located. Just head straight and follow the signs.
Taxi or Ride-Sharing (Ola/Uber)
Using a taxi or a ride-sharing service like Ola or Uber is a convenient option. Simply enter 'Paigah Tombs' or 'Qalender Nagar Rd, Santosh Nagar, Hyderabad' as your destination. The estimated fare from central Hyderabad is around ₹200-₹400 depending on traffic. This option provides door-to-door service and is great for those traveling with family or in groups.
Auto-Rickshaw
You can also take an auto-rickshaw from various parts of Hyderabad. Make sure to negotiate the fare before your journey or ensure that the meter is running. A ride from nearby areas like MG Bus Station to the Paigah Tombs should cost around ₹50-₹100. The auto-rickshaw drivers are usually familiar with the location, so you can simply ask for the Paigah Tombs.
